Understanding Each Key Type

  1. Conventional Keys

    • These are one of the most fundamental keys utilized in older cars. They are usually made from metal and feature no electronic parts. Replacement is often straightforward and normally requires a locksmith or dealer.
  2. Transponder Keys

    • Transponder keys come equipped with a chip that sends a special signal to the vehicle's ignition system. If the key isn't acknowledged, the vehicle won't begin. Changing a transponder key typically includes not just cutting a brand-new key however also setting the chip, which can increase both the complexity and expense of replacement.
  3. Smart Keys

    • Smart keys use sophisticated innovation allowing for keyless entry and ignition. Instead of placing a key, drivers should have the smart key within proximity to start their vehicle. Replacing clever keys can be pricey due to the innovation included.
  4. Remote Key Fobs

    • These devices allow remote locks and other functions like panic buttons or trunk release. Replacement typically consists of the requirement to synchronize the fob with the vehicle's system, which can be done through a dealership or a locksmith.
  5. Valet Keys

    • Developed for short-term usage, these keys usually offer access to just essential functions. The replacement process is comparable to conventional keys, as they do not include any innovative parts.

The Car Key Replacement Process

The procedure for replacing a car key can vary depending upon the key type and the car model. Here's a general summary of the actions included:

Step-by-Step Key Replacement Process

  1. Determine the Key Type:

    • Determine whether the key is a conventional, transponder, smart key, or remote fob.
  2. Collect Necessary Information:

    • Have your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) and evidence of ownership ready to assist in the replacement procedure.
  3. Pick a replacement keys for car Method:

    • Dealership: The most trusted technique, however typically the most costly. Best for smart keys and complex transponder keys.
    • Locksmith: A more inexpensive choice if dealing with conventional or some transponder keys. Look for specialists in automotive key replacement keys.
    • Online Services: Websites exist that offer key cutting and programming services; however, care is encouraged with potential security threats.
  4. Program the Key:

    • If applicable, programs must be carried out to sync the brand-new key with the vehicle's systems. This can require specialized devices often available at a dealership or automotive locksmith professional.
  5. Evaluate the Key:

    • After replacement, test the brand-new key's functionality to ensure it operates all car functions, including ignition and remote functions.

Costs of Car Key Replacement

The expenses of car key replacements can vary widely based upon multiple elements, such as key type, vehicle make and design, and the replacement approach. Below is a breakdown of typical expenses connected with various key types.

Key TypeApproximated Cost Range
Conventional Keys₤ 2 - ₤ 10
Transponder Keys₤ 50 - ₤ 250
Smart Keys₤ 200 - ₤ 600
Remote Key Fobs₤ 50 - ₤ 300
Valet Keys₤ 5 - ₤ 20

Extra Factors Affecting Cost

  • Intricacy of Programming: The more complex the key innovation, the greater the shows fee.
  • Place: Prices might differ by region due to differing labor rates and expense of living.
  • Emergency Services: Expect to pay more for urgent or emergency locksmith services, particularly outside routine company hours.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. The length of time does it take to replace a car key?

The time taken varies based on the type of key and the replacement technique. For conventional keys, it might take simply a couple of minutes. For sophisticated clever keys, it can take longer due to programming.

2. What if I've lost my car keys completely?

If you've lost all your keys, you might require to call a car dealership for a complete key reprogramming and replacement considering that they can produce a brand-new key based on your VIN.

3. Can I still drive my car without a key?

No, you can not. If you've lost your key, you'll need to replace it before you can begin the vehicle once again.

4. Is it possible to program a new key myself?

While it's possible for some simpler keys, most contemporary keys-- specifically transponder and smart keys-- require specific devices and skills for appropriate programming.
